Output 5268b72fe4b53ec2fd523ea3a002b343fd9367ff911630a5026b09c4b58e1197:4

value
18519684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015725fe1610f147ff3197919db748387a2613b6 OP_EQUAL
address
31p6zuv5d6te6o8Lh7ZgCF3RREDZ73yurX
transaction
5268b72fe4b53ec2fd523ea3a002b343fd9367ff911630a5026b09c4b58e1197
spent
true